152. When the technique known as gene-splicing was invented in the early 1970's, it was feared that scientists might inadvertently create an "Andromeda strain," a microbe never before seen on Earth that might escape from the laboratory and it would kill vast numbers of humans who would have no natural defenses against it.

(A)it would kill vast numbers of humans who would have no natural defenses against it
(B)it might kill vast numbers of humans with no natural defenses against it
(C)kill vast numbers of humans who would have no natural defenses against it
(D)kill vast numbers of humans who have no natural defenses against them
(E)kill vast numbers of humans with no natural defenses against them


This sentence requires parallel verb forms within the relative clause that might escape... and kill. C, the best choice, uses parallel verb forms that are followed appropriately by the conditional would have in the who clause that modifies humans. Choices A and B each violate parallel construction by introducing a new independent clause, it would kill... and it might kill... Though choices D and E begin by observing parallelism, the use of them at the end of each creates a problem of pronoun reference: them cannot refer to the singular microbe. In addition, choices B, D, and E lack would and thus do not express the conditional.

帖子dibert8 » 2008-09-19 14:24

(E) 錯在代名詞數量不一致 (them 應該是 it)
with 最可能修飾的就是 humans, 修飾上應該沒有太大的問題
用 with 其實改變句意了. with 修飾 humans, 表示沒有免疫力的無一倖免;原句用的是假設語氣:沒有免疫力的可能會死.
